Homemade Dog Agility Jumps. Purchasing a dog agility jump can be expensive. They help your dog build strength in its hindquarters and improve its sense of spatial awareness. If you have an energetic pup that doesn't tire out, agility courses can be a great way to burn off some steam. However, you can make your own cheaply with some pvc pipe and a few tools. Today we are going to teach you how to build your own agility jumps for backyard fun with your dog. Petful provides a great set of diy plans that’ll allow you to build your dog a complete agility course, including a jump, tunnels, a seesaw, a pause table, and a set of weave poles.
